2. Referrals:
a. Horseshoe Harbor Yacht Club —Pier Reconstruction
Referred by the Village of Larchmont Building Department
Craig Plate, Keith Lundgren, Pam Michels and John Santalone presented their plans
for the reconstruction of the Pier at the Horseshoe Harbor Yacht Club that was
destroyed during a storm.
CZMC found the proposed action to be consistent with the policies in the LWRP.
However, it was recommended that the club consider modifying the design, allowing
the ramp to be raised, in order to protect it from storm damage.

3. LWRP Discussion
Charles McCaffrey led the discussion of the policies pertaining to Energy Conservation,
Air Quality and Solid and Hazardous Waste. It was agreed that the proposed policies in
the LWRP must support the Town and Village efforts to conserve energy, reduce
greenhouse gases, prevent flooding and erosion. Plans prepared by the Town and Village
should be reviewed to ensure that they do not conflict with the LWRP's policies and that
current laws and plans do not prevent these goals from being achieved.
Separate work sessions are recommended for the next three discussion topics, which
include: Water Quality, Wildlife Habitat and Flooding & Erosion. Charles will speak
with Stephen Altieri about reviewing these documents and will update him on our new
work schedule, which will need to be extended until May or June.
